How To Diagnose It

Start with the basics. Check your stack trace—is there a more typical Python error right before the 0297xud8 python code error message? If so, focus on fixing that issue. This custom error code is likely a wrapper over a deeper problem.

Steps to break it down:

  1. Read the Full Traceback

Scroll up from the error message and follow the call stack. Look for lines pointing to your code or common libraries like requests, pandas, or NumPy.

  1. Check Version Compatibility

Tools like pipdeptree, pip freeze, and conda list help verify if your Python packages are aligned correctly.

  1. Log Warning Details

If logging is used in your app, tweak log level to DEBUG and rerun. Misleading log levels are one reason devs miss this error.

  1. Reproduce in Clean Env

Spin up a fresh virtual environment or use Docker with minimal modules and test the smallest version of your function.
